Russian and European professors believe that the Bologna process has a negative impact on the training of engineers. These are the preliminary results of the public discussion initiated by Vladimir Litvinenko, Rector of the St. Petersburg Mining University. Of course, there is nothing surprising about this, but the surprise is completely different. Western technical universities have introduced a two-tier system of higher education (bachelor's and master's degrees) only by word of mouth. In fact, their curricula are much more constructive.

In other words, if we ignore the nuances, the Old World imposed standards on our universities that reduced the requirements for graduates and led to an acute shortage of competent engineers in Russia, but it is guided by completely different approaches. Forpost decided to find out what the differences are and what we need to do to urgently rectify the situation.

So, the main disadvantage of four-year training programs, which are now the foundation of domestic higher education, is that only a few weeks are set aside for on-the-job practice in them. As a result, young people enter the labor market without work experience in real production, which a priori reduces their competitiveness and attractiveness in the eyes of the employer.

Some of the bachelor's graduates subsequently graduate with a master's degree and thus increase their demand on the part of business. But there are comparatively few budget places, so it is unrealistic to ensure the mass graduation of engineers in this way. In addition, the second stage of higher education is designed primarily for those who plan to build a research career, which means that future engineers have to compete for the diploma with young scientists, which is quite strange.

Things are quite different in Europe. For example, in Austria, where the system is formally painfully similar to the Russian reality, all engineering students are obliged to enter the master's program after their bachelor's degree. The quotas allocated by the state are enough for that. In addition, one of the prerequisites for obtaining a diploma is a six-month internship.

"Of course, there are isolated cases where students for some reason do not continue their studies after the bachelor's degree. But in general, the educational process in Austria is organized in such a way that almost all engineering students complete their master's degree, i.e. the entire cycle. The Bachelor's program includes a six-month compulsory internship, which can be completed in one or three two-month periods. The most important thing is to stick with it, six months," said Leoben University Rector Peter Moser.

In Britain there is no requirement to continue after the first stage of education has been completed. However, the 4-year education has a distinctly practical orientation.

"We're trying to make our four-year training match the traditional system, which involves five years of classes. The first two years of the curriculum are about the same, and then we start to specialize. Then, in the third year, our students get practical training, which takes six months. In other words, we can say that we have joined the Bologna Process, but in fact, it's not quite like that. The task of fully complying with its principles is not in front of us," explains Eric Yatman, professor of microengineering at Imperial College London.

In Germany, it seems that no one has ever heard of the Bologna Process. The minimum period of study there is 5 years. For the final attestation the student must write a scientific paper, which becomes his calling card for employment. Another condition is a report on the results of industrial practice.

"It may well be that three to four years is enough for humanities students, but it is impossible to train a good engineer in that time. Our curricula stipulate a lower threshold of five years, although young people can study even longer. The main thing is not to exceed twice the total period. For example, if five years are initially given to obtain a profession, the deadline is ten. With regard to practice, a special semester is allocated for it. All students are sent to a company or an enterprise of their choice. There they take part in a project and write a detailed report," says Carsten Drebenstedt, professor at the Freiberg Mining Academy.

What about us? Paradoxically enough, but 20 years ago, unlike the Europeans, we took a "blind eye" and blindly copied all of the Bachelor's degree standards prescribed in the Bologna Agreement. Of course, we wanted the best, to join the European educational community, in which all members recognize the high status of diplomas issued in other states that have signed the convention, including Russia. But it turned out as usual - in the West the value of our documents on higher education has remained zero. On the other hand, as the employers say, "half-trained" people have begun to leave the ranks of Russian universities.

The main complaint to the bachelor's degree programs is too short a period of work practice. Two-three weeks in the third year are enough just to get the general idea about a company. Students do not have time to go into the essence of specific technological processes, let alone take part in their implementation. As a result almost nobody wants them on the labor market, business "hunts" for graduates of specialist's degree, who studied for five and a half years and had a long pre-diploma internship. The problem is that there is a catastrophic shortage of them.

Mikhail Gordin, Acting Rector of Bauman Moscow State Technical University, specifies: "The university has preserved the specialty programs for training engineers." Their share is 45%, which is quite a good indicator by the standards of the country. But many areas of study, such as Informatics and Computer Engineering, Electrical and Thermal Power Engineering, Materials Technology, and Management in Technical Systems, provide exclusively for Bachelor's and Master's degrees.

What kind of technological sovereignty can we talk about then? Its foundation is the continuity of generations in science and industry, and this has obviously been broken 20 years ago. The change in production comes not thanks to, but in spite of the prevailing circumstances.

"We receive numerous appeals from the management of enterprises, first of all, of the military-industrial complex, which raise the issue of the shortage of qualified engineering personnel. The shortage of developers of new equipment and technologies, who are able to solve problems related to the preservation of Russia's technological sovereignty, is obvious. Therefore I consider it unconditionally necessary to train such specialists under programs of 5.5 to 6 years in length. At the same time, taking into account the industry specifics and the nature of the future professional activity of the graduates, within the framework of the educational field of Engineering, Technology, and Technical Sciences, the possibility of a 4-year education should also be preserved," Mikhail Gordin believes.

The Rector of Ugra State University Roman Kuchin is sure that "it is simply impossible to provide the change of generations in the industries that are significant for the development of Russia - rocket and space, nuclear, mineral and raw materials and fuel and energy complex" without higher school reforms.

"In 4 years, higher education institutions do not have time to prepare a graduate who meets all the necessary competencies. It takes a long time for a bachelor to adapt to production, e.g. at a power plant, electric grid company, or oil field, and is not an easy task for both the young specialist and the employer. The master's program, prepares graduates aimed at a research career. Graduate students are more prepared for postgraduate studies than for employment as leading engineers," notes Roman Kuchin.

Natalya Gordina, Rector of Ivanovo State University of Chemical Technology, has no doubt that the main model of higher education should be "a 5-year specialist program that will provide students with a deeper immersion in the field of study and allow them to master more complex competencies necessary for a successful career in engineering."

"The extra time will allow more emphasis on the practical part of the training, which will greatly improve the quality of the graduates. We propose to modify the curriculum so that in the 5th year students could combine work and study," says Natalia Gordina.

The rector of St. Petersburg Mining University, Vladimir Litvinenko, who publicly discussed the draft strategy to radically improve the quality of training and use of specialists with higher technical education, received a great many suggestions. There were even more words of support, because no one doubts, perhaps, the necessity of reforming the domestic higher school.

The general opinion: to adapt the graduate to the needs of the market will be possible only in case of transition to training specialists with higher education within 5-6 years. In this case theoretical knowledge alone is not enough. They should be reinforced by the skills obtained in laboratories, simulators, training grounds and, of course, production sites.

It should be reminded that Vladimir Putin suggested returning to the traditional system of higher education in order to reduce the shortage of engineering personnel. This initiative was voiced about two months ago, within the framework of the Russian President's message to the Federal Assembly.
